The City Council (the "City Council") of the City of Hermosa Beach (the "City") by its Resolution No. 96-5811 (the "Resolution of Intention"), declared its intention to order improvements, including the installation and construction of street improvements and street -related improvements in the proposed Lower Pier Avenue Assessment District (the "Assessment District") pursuant to the provisions of the Municipal Improvement Act of 1913 (California Streets and Highways Code Section 10000, et seq.) (the "1913 Act") and ordered the Assessment Engineer to prepare and file a report (the "Engineer's Report") with the City Clerk in accordance with Section 10204 of the 1913 Act and containing the information required by Section 2961 of Division 4 of the California Streets and Highways Code. B. The City Council by its Resolution No. 96-5817, adopted on June 25, 1996, preliminarily approved the Engineer's Report entitled "Engineer's Report, Hermosa Beach, Lower Pier Avenue Assessment District," which Engineer's Report is on file in the office of the City Clerk. C. By its Resolution No. 96-5824, adopted on August 13, 1996, the City Council amended the Resolution of Intention to provide for the City to comply with the requirements of the Special Assessment Investigation, Limitation and Majority Protest Act of 1931, Division 4 of the California Streets and Highways Code, by proceeding under Part 7.5 thereof. D. The Assessment Engineer has presented to the City Clerk, and the City Clerk has presented to the City Council at this meeting, certain proposed modifications to the Engineer's Report. Such modifications include the addition of information required by Streets and Highways Code Section 2961 in order to comply with the requirements of the Division 4 of the Streets and Highways Code, by proceeding under Part 7.5 thereof. The Engineer's Report, as modified, is on file in the office of the City Clerk and is available for public inspection. 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 28 NOW, THEREFORE, TH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F HERMOSA BEACH HEREBY FINDS, DETERMINES, RESOLVES AND ORDERS AS FOLLOWS: SECTION 1. The City Council hereby preliminarily approves the modified 1 Engineer's Report as presented by the Assessment Engineer at this meeting and now on file in the office of the City Clerk. SECTION 2. The City Council hereby appoints October 22, 1996, at 7:00 p.m., in the Council Chambers, 1315 Valley Drive, Hermosa Beach, California, as the time and place for hearing protests to the proposed improvements, the extent of the proposed assessment district, and the proposed assessment against lots and parcels of land within the proposed assessment district. SECTION 3. The City Clerk is hereby directed to give notice of such hearing in I accordance with law. SECTION 4. The City Council hereby designates Ms. Amy Amirani, Director of Public Works, City of Hermosa Beach, 1315 Valley Drive, Hermosa Beach, California 90254- 3685, telephone number (310) 318-0211, to answer inquiries regarding the protest proceedings. PASSED, APPROVED and ADOPTED this 13th day of August, 1996.
